THE FIRST TIME THIS HAPPENED, I WAS DRIVING ON THE HIGHWAY AT APPROXIMATELY 75 MPH IN THE CENTER LANE OF AN EXPRESS ROAD. WHILE DRIVING, THE TPMS SENSOR WARNING LIGHT/SOUND CAME ON AND THE TIRE WENT IMMEDIATELY FLATE - TOTAL CATASTROPHIC FAILURE. I WAS ABLE TO PULL OFF TO THE SIDE OF THE ROAD WITHOUT FURTHER INCIDENT AND WHEN WE LOOKED AT THE TIRE, THE TPMS SENSOR HAD FALLEN OUT CAUSING THE TIRE TO GO FLAT (IT IS ATTACHED TO THE VALVE STEM) THE TREADS WERE CORRODED AND THE NUT CRACKED CAUSING THE SENSOR FALL OUT AND THE TIRE TO GO FLAT. THIS ONE WAS REPLACED. 8 MONTHS LATER, THE SAME THING HAPPENED BUT THIS TIME ON THE DRIVER'S SIDE FRONT TIRE. THE NUT CRACKED AND THE SENSOR FELL OUT CAUSING THE TIRE TO GO FLAT. THANKFULLY THIS TIME IT HAPPENED JUST AFTER I HAD PULLED OFF THE HIGHWAY FOR A BATHROOM BREAK AND WAS NOT DRIVING AT SPEED WHEN THE SECOND INCIDENT OCCURRED - ALTHOUGH IF IT HAD HAPPENED A FEW MINUTES PRIOR, I WOULD HAVE BEEN DRIVING AT APPROXIMATELY 75 MPH IN WET ROAD CONDITIONS. UPON EXAMINATION WE FOUND THAT THE THREAD WERE AGAIN CORRODED, CAUSING THE NUT TO CRACK AND THE SENSOR TO FALL OUT. THIS IS A VERY DANGEROUS SITUATION - CATASTROPHIC FAILURE OF A TIRE AT HIGHWAY SPEEDS IS A RECIPE FOR DISASTER. THIS SITUATION SHOULD BE TAKEN VERY SERIOUSLY BY MAZDA. *TR

Official recalls

2

11V329000 · Visibility:windshield Wiper/washer:motor

Jun 15, 2011

MAZDA IS RECALLING CERTAIN MODEL YEAR 2008-2009 MAZDA3 AND MAZDASPEED3 VEHICLES MANUFACTURED FROM JANUARY 7, 2008, THROUGH NOVEMBER 28, 2008. THE GROUND TERMINAL OF THE WINDSHIELD WIPER MOTOR MAY HAVE BEEN INADVERTENTLY BENT DURING ASSEMBLY. IF THIS CONDITION EXISTS THEN OVER TIME THE ELECTRICAL RESISTANCE OF THE MOTOR CIRCUIT MAY INCREASE UP TO A POINT THAT THE WINDSHIELD WIPERS WOULD NOT WORK.

Consequence & remedy

Consequence: THE LOSS OF WIPER FUNCTION IN ADVERSE WEATHER COULD POTENTIALLY INCREASE THE RISK OF A CRASH.

Remedy: DEALERS WILL INSTALL AN ADDITIONAL GROUND HARNESS ON THE WIPER MOTOR FREE OF CHARGE. THE SAFETY RECALL IS EXPECTED TO BEGIN ON OR BEFORE JULY 15, 2011. OWNERS MAY CONTACT MAZDA CUSTOMER ASSISTANCE CENTER AT 1-800-222-5500.

10V374000 · Steering:electric Power Assist System

Aug 12, 2010

MAZDA IS RECALLING CERTAIN MODEL YEAR 2007-2009 MAZDA3 AND MAZDA5 VEHICLES MANUFACTURED FROM APRIL 2, 2007 THROUGH NOVEMBER 30, 2008. THESE VEHICLES MAY HAVE A CONDITION IN WHICH A SUDDEN LOSS OF POWER STEERING ASSIST COULD OCCUR AT ANY TIME WHILE DRIVING THE VEHICLE.

Consequence & remedy

Consequence: POWER STEERING ASSIST IS SUDDENLY LOST REDUCING THE DRIVER'S ABILITY TO STEER THE VEHICLE AS TYPICALLY EXPECTED, AND INCREASING THE RISK OF A CRASH.

Remedy: MAZDA WILL NOTIFY OWNERS, AND DEALERS WILL REPLACE THE POWER STEERING PUMP AND LINES FREE OF CHARGE. THE SAFETY RECALL BEGAN ON SEPTEMBER 15, 2010. OWNERS MAY CONTACT MAZDA CUSTOMER ASSISTANCE CENTER AT 1-800-222-5500.

NHTSA investigations

1

PE10021 · Loss Of Electric Power Steering Assist

Opened Jun 28, 2010 · Closed Nov 29, 2010

Status: closed (inferred from source dates) · Steering; Steering:electric Power Assist System; Steering:hydraulic Power Assist System; Steering:hydraulic Power Assist:hose, Piping, And Connections; Steering:hydraulic Power Assist:power Steering Fluid; Steering:hydraulic Power Assist:pump

The subject vehicles have electro-hydraulic power assist steering (EHPAS).The complaint counts shown above alleged a loss of power steering assist in the subject vehicles.Usually, but not always, the loss is accompanied by the simultaneous lighting of an indicator light on the dash.The complaints include 14 alleged crashes involving 6 injuries.On Mazda3 and Mazda5 vehicles manufactured from April 2, 2007 through November 30, 2008, rust may have formed inside the EPAS high-pressure pipe during manufacture due to improper processing.If the rust is present it may damage the power steering pump bearings leading to an increased load on the electric motor; this results in an elevated operating temperature for the EPAS system.To prevent excessive overheating of the system, which could potentially cause permanent damage, afailsafe mode which de-powers the electric pump is implemented.This causes a loss of power assist making it more difficult to steer the vehicle, especially at lower vehicle speeds.Once the failsafe is implemented the EPAS system will remain disabled until the ignition is turned off.However EPAS will be re-enabled if the operating temperature is reduced (i.e., within an acceptable range) on a subsequent drive cycle.On August 8, 2010 Mazda submitted a Part 573 defect information report initiating Safety Recall 10V-374 to remedy the subject vehicles.The report, which contains additional details on the remedy repair, is available at http://www-odi.nhtsa.dot.gov/recalls/.ODI notes that the affected population shown in that report includes approximately 8,000 vehicles Mazda repaired prior to initiating the recall.
